The Urgency to Go Green
Traditional commercial cleaning methods often involve the use of harsh chemicals, excessive water consumption, and wasteful practices that can harm the environment and compromise health. Adopting eco-friendly cleaning practices is now essential for monitoring your business’ environmental impact. Sustainable cleaning practices minimize the use of harmful chemicals, leading to a healthier planet by conserving water and energy resources. Not only this, opting for non-toxic cleaning products creates a safer and healthier workspace, benefiting both your employees and the occupants of the area.
Eco-Friendly Cleaning Products
Eco-friendly cleaning products are at the heart of sustainable cleaning practices. These products are designed to be gentle on the environment, safe for human health, and highly effective at cleaning. They often include non-toxic, biodegradable ingredients that break down naturally, reducing their impact on the ecosystem. By opting for eco-friendly cleaning products, you not only ensure a cleaner workspace but also contribute to a healthier planet.
Consider Conservation
In addition to using eco-friendly products, consider implementing conservation measures within your cleaning routines. This includes water-saving techniques, energy-efficient equipment, and waste reduction strategies. For instance, using low-flow mop buckets with wringers can help control water usage, while choosing cleaning machines that are designed to use less water and energy can further minimize your environmental footprint. Encouraging recycling and reusing cleaning materials can significantly reduce waste within your facilities. Even simple changes like eco-friendly light bulb options and scheduling cleaning during daylight hours can slowly cut back unneeded energy usage.
Educate Employees
These green practices can only go so far without educating your staff. Make sure they are well-informed about the eco-friendly products and practices being implemented. Training your employees on the proper use of green cleaning products and techniques will ensure that these practices are effectively integrated into your cleaning routines. Their active participation in eco-friendly cleaning efforts can further enhance your business’s reputation and sustainability goals.
